Sale of toiletries is underway

The measures announced by Betsy Díaz Velázquez, head of the Ministry of Domestic Trade (Mincin by its Spanish acronyms), on the sale of some products released and not subsidized through the regular card of basic supplies and the network of regular stores, is already materialized in Las Tunas with the distribution of toiletries.

Las Tunas, Cuba - Rolando Rodríguez Rojas, director of the Business Group of Commerce in the province, told 26Digital that the process began in the municipality of Puerto Padre and is expected to reach each family by April 20.

"At the moment we have the necessary bath soap to cover the entire population", said the director. We still have to receive part of the washing soap, which will arrive in the next few days. The sale of both is planned to take place monthly.

"With respect to the toothpaste and liquid detergent, the distribution will be in the quarter, since the existing raw material is quite limited. In the territory, we have a portion of toothpaste and we will start to take it to the regular stores, but we need the population to understand that the expected quantities will be sold, according to the number of consumers per family, taking into account the time needed for it to reach all families.

"Next week we will start offering a pound of chicken per capita at 20.00 pesos, in the same way, its distribution will be through the regular card of basic supplies and in correspondence with the arrival here of this merchandise".

Rodriguez Rojas explained that since the beginning of the week, the 19 products of the basic basket of the month of April began to be commercialized in the eight tuner municipalities, this time with 10 additional ounces of peas per consumer.

In the case of the sale of chlorine, the executive argued that to date 56,380 families have been covered, but the disinfectant is available to cover the rest. In the Balcony of Eastern Cuba, 52 points of sales are able for this activity and are expected to increase, as the levels of supply do it.
